Role Description
Are you a recent masters graduate in a STEM discipline (e.g., Chemistry, Physics, Biology, Pharmacy, or Engineering) looking to transition from academia to industry but not sure how to take the first step?
We are excited to announce four open positions for Subject Matter Experts (SME) at Innerspace. Our Frame-by-Frame Academy is designed to train the next generation of industry experts in Pharma Manufacturing and Quality Risk Management, combining the best of pharmaceutical and cutting-edge software innovation.
Requirements
  • MSc graduates in Chemistry, Physics, Engineering, Biology, Pharmacy or similar
  • Data-driven, open-minded, with great attention to detail
  • Strong communication skills and team spirit
Conditions and Benefits
  • Miminimum gross salary of 45.000 € per year (overpayment possible) 
  • Flexible working time and the possibility to work from home
  • Permanent full-time contract (38,5 h / week)
  • A chance to move to or stay in Innsbruck, in the heart of the Alps, and join a dynamic, international team of young scientists
  • Mobility package (1-year ticket for public transport in Tyrol or a parking space near the office)
  • Hands-on learning with one of the richest real-world datasets in Aseptic Processing
  • Direct exposure to cutting-edge industry trends in pharma and digital solutions
  • A structured pathway to build your expertise in Quality Risk Management — a fast-growing area with massive global impact
  • Build international networks in pharma
